I would not disagree with PR. Ali knows his stuff!
The photos of the clownfish Edwing posted are "babies from Onyx parents". I know for sure that not all the babies will develop and mature to become Onyx like their parents. I am also very sure than Rod's Onyx is very special. Their black coloration does get in faster. It is true that there isn't any "Onyx babies", just "babies from Onyx parents".
